Each semester, students enrolling at a community college must pay a tuition cost of $20 per credit hour plus a $40 registration processing fee.
A) Write a linear equation that gives the total cost c to be paid by a student enrolling at the college and taking x credit hours.
.
c(x) = 20x + 40
.
b)Find the enrollment cost for a student taking 12 credit hours.
.
c(x) = 20x + 40
c(12) = 20(12) + 40
c(12) = 240 + 40
c(12) = $280
